Make Chocolate Chip Muffin Buns

Have you ever stood at a bakery counter, torn between a decadent chocolate chip muffin and a soft, buttery dinner roll? We certainly have. That’s why we’ve perfected the Chocolate Chip Muffin Bun.
Prep Time1 hour 35 minutes
Cook Time25 minutes
Total Time2 hours
Course: Appetizer
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• Warm Milk: 1.5 cups 105°F–110°F
  • Sugar: 4 tbsp granulated
  • Salt: 1 tsp
  • Yeast: 1 packet 10g instant dry yeast
  • Egg: 1 large
  • Oil: ½ cup vegetable or canola oil
  • Flour: 4 cups all-purpose plus extra for kneading
  • Chocolate Chips: 1 cup semi-sweet
  • Optional: Chocolate hazelnut spread for filling

Instructions

  • Activate Yeast: Combine warm milk, sugar, salt, and yeast in a bowl. Let sit for 10 minutes until foamy.
  • Mix Dough: Add egg and oil to the yeast mixture. Gradually stir in flour until a dough forms.
  • Knead: Knead on a floured surface for 5–8 minutes until smooth and elastic.
  • First Rise: Place dough in a greased bowl, cover, and let rise in a warm spot for 1 hour (until doubled).
  • Add Chocolate: Punch down the dough, add chocolate chips, and knead gently to distribute.
  • Shape & Second Rise: Divide into 12 equal pieces. Roll into balls and place in a greased muffin tin. Cover and rise for 15 minutes.
  • Bake: Brush tops with milk. Bake in a preheated oven at 180°C (350°F) for 20–25 minutes until golden brown.
  • Finish: Once cooled slightly, core the center and fill with chocolate spread if desired.
